What did the two sides do during the unofficial Christmas truce of World War 1?

They shared food, sang Christmas songs and played ball.

Does Australia celebrate Christmas in summer?

Yes. Christmas occurs on 25 December, just as it does everywhere else in the world, but this occurs during Australia's summer.
